Regular software updates and program maintenance are vital preventive measures to keep your pc healthy. Software updates assist in removing bugs, security flaws, and enhancing pc performance. Some of the essential software that requires routine upgrades include operating systems, web browsers, and antivirus software. Program repair involves tasks like hard drive cleaning, defragmentation, and deleting temporary files. These jobs help improve your system’s performance by removing unneeded files and fixing mistakes that may trigger slow performance or crashes.
Regular backups also form part of program maintenance to ensure you can return important information in case of unexpected data loss. Ultimately, regular software updates and program servicing are critical to keep your pc running smoothly and free from problems.
One of the most significant protective measures to keep your pc healthier is to use anti-virus software. This program is made to identify and get rid of malware, viruses, and other malicious software that could damage your computer. There are many different types of anti-virus programs available on the market, some of which are free and others that require a membership. When choosing an anti-virus system, make sure to select one that is trustworthy and has a track record of properly protecting computers from risks.
When installed, it’s important to maintain the software up to date by regularly downloading updates and running scans on your computer. By keeping your computer virus-free with an anti-virus application, you can prevent possible damage and ensure that your programs run smoothly.
Your computer must be protected from malware and phishing attacks by having healthy browsing habits. Avoiding clicking on dubious connections or downloading files from unreliable sources is one of the most crucial things you can do. Be wary of emails that appear to be from legitimate businesses or organizations but ask you to click on a link or give personal details.
Always triple-check the URL of any site you visit, especially if it requires you to enter sensitive information like passwords or credit card numbers. Furthermore, consider using a reputable antivirus program and keeping it updated frequently. You can significantly lower your risk of being the victim of malware and phishing attacks by adopting these secure browsing practices.

To keep your pc good, it’s important to prevent physical damage to its components. One way to do this is by keeping your computer in a secure and stable place. Avoid placing it near places where there is a danger of spillage or on unpredictable surfaces that may cause it to fall. Making sure the computer has adequate ventilation is another crucial preventative measure as it can cause the device to overheat and break. This happens a lot with laptops when people use them on the bed or other places where it will be difficult to ventilate the heat.
Overheating may cause damage to internal pieces, so make sure the fans and vents are unimpeded and free from dust accumulation. Furthermore, when transporting or cleaning your computer, it’s important to handle it carefully. Usually use an appropriate carrying case and soft cleaning products designed for electronic devices.
